Farmingdale State - 27, Penn-State Abington - 1

Farmingdale, N.Y. - The Farmingdale State men's lacrosse team defeated non-conference opponent Penn State-Abington, 27-1, this afternoon in Farmingdale, N.Y. The Rams improved to 8-3 with today's victory and the Nittany Lions fell to 0-8 with the loss.

Farmingdale State took control of the game right from the start, scoring 11 goals in the first period. The Rams added five goals in the second and took a 16-0 lead into halftime. Farmingdale State outscored the Nittany Lions 11-1 in the second half and went on for the 27-1 victory.

Sophomore attack Bill McGarvey (Sayville, N.Y./Sayville) scored a team-high five goals and added one assist for the Rams. Senior attack Sean Maxwell (West Babylon, N.Y./West Babylon) had three goals and four assists, while freshman midfielder Mike O'Brien (Garden City, N.Y./The Canterbury School) scored three as well. Junior attack Wes Hubschmitt (Seaford, N.Y./Seaford) pitched in scoring two goals and recorded a game-high seven assists. The Rams were 29-of-32 on faceoffs.

Sophomore goalkeeper Patrick Delventhal (Westbury, N.Y./Holy Trinity) had four saves in the win, while goalies Ron Rossi (Levittown, Penn./Harry S. Truman) and Dominic Colarusso (Newtown, Penn./Council Rock North) combined for 12 saves in the defeat for Penn State-Abington.

Farmingdale State will host Mount Saint Vincent in a Skyline Conference game on Tuesday, April 6th at 4:00 p.m.
